Ian Morgan tells the story of Bolsover Castle from the humble Norman beginnings to today's beautiful shadow of its former glory.

The present 17th century castle stands as a monument to the Cavendish family who lavished money and love on their "Pleasure Palace", leaving as their legacy a romantic ruin and stunning paintings within the "Little Castle".
